Feature Descriptions
Website Classification
The core functionality that categorizes websites into hierarchical categories based on content analysis. Provides accurate classification of domains across 621 different categories.
Content Categorization
Analyzes the actual content on webpages to determine relevant categories, not just domain-level categorization. This enables more granular and accurate content understanding.
Domain Analysis
Provides comprehensive domain information including registration data, related domains, and overall domain reputation metrics.
URL Classification
Categorizes specific URLs rather than just domains, allowing for page-level content classification for sites with diverse content.
IAB Taxonomy Mapping
Maps categorized content to the Interactive Advertising Bureau (IAB) taxonomy, making it valuable for advertising and content monetization purposes.
Company Information Retrieval
Extracts company details like name, description, size, revenue, location, and other business-relevant information from domains.
Audience Targeting Insights
Provides data useful for understanding audience demographics and interests based on content categorization.
Automated Content Tagging
Automatically generates relevant tags for content, making content organization and discovery more efficient.

Technical Approach to Classifying Wildlife Conservation Content
Klazify's technical approach to classifying wildlife conservation content involves several key processes:
- Content Scraping: Klazify scrapes the content of websites to gather relevant data for analysis.
- Natural Language Processing (NLP): Advanced NLP techniques are employed to understand the context and semantics of the content, allowing for accurate categorization.
- Machine Learning Models: Klazify utilizes machine learning algorithms that continuously learn from new data, improving classification accuracy over time.
- Feedback Loop: User feedback and interaction data are integrated into the system to refine and enhance the classification process.
